## Deployment Notes — Payroll Export

Heads up for the weekly sync: Ledgerhop's payroll export moves from fixed-width to delimited format in this release. The Brickmoor clearing partner already accepts both, so no coordination window is needed. Old exports remain readable; the importer auto-detects format. Deploy order: exporter first, then the reconciliation worker. Do not enable the new format flag until both are live. The exporter reads these values from its environment at startup.

deployment values, yadug-bawif:
[framir]
team = pelox
access_code = ac_a38ab2
owner = tamion.julael
host = framir.tolvaqlabs.test
port = 11211
peer = tammir.zemvargrid.local
salt = 2215ef03
pin = 1541

Onboarding note for the Ledgerpane admin table: bulk edits are applied through the batcher service, not directly against the database. Select rows, choose an action, and the batcher stages changes in a pending set you can review before commit. Edits over 500 rows require a second approver — this is enforced server-side, so don't try to chunk around it. To run the batcher locally you need the staging write credential, which goes in your .env as the next line.

secret setting of bahip-kagag: RELAY_SECRET3=c83

### Audit item 14: Crash-report pipeline (Pinloft mobile)

Verify crash payloads from the Pinloft app are scrubbed of user text before upload. Check the symbolication worker drops reports older than 30 days. Confirm sampling rate matches the value in ops/crash.yaml, not the hardcoded fallback. Breadcrumb buffers must cap at 64 entries. Retention job logs go to the Cobbleton archive bucket. Reviewer should confirm no PII fields survive the redaction pass. Accountability for this pipeline sits with the engineer listed below.

named custodian: Belius Casath Ulaix Sorius

## v4.2.1 — Changed defaults

Fixed the websocket reconnect bug in PulseLink where clients hammered the gateway after a dropped connection. Reconnect backoff is now exponential with jitter instead of fixed-interval, and the max retry count was raised. Existing deployments inherit the new defaults unless explicitly overridden. The new default configuration values shipped with this release are as follows.

settings of tajeg-fahap:
quenael:
  log_level: debug
  metrics_host: metrics.quenael.zemvarlabs.internal
  pin: 8863
  pool_size: 16